NetHunter是一款由PentestBox开发的开源Android操作系统,专为渗透测试和安全研究而设计。它允许用户在一个安全的环境中执行各种安全测试,如网络扫描、漏洞评估等。本文将详细介绍如何轻松上手NetHunter,并揭秘哪些手机型号完美适配NetHunter。
1. 了解NetHunter
NetHunter最初是为基于Android的Nexus设备设计的,但随着时间的推移,它已经扩展到支持更多型号的手机和平板。NetHunter提供了丰富的工具和功能,包括但不限于:
- Kali Linux渗透测试工具集
- VPN支持
- 网络监控和嗅探工具
- 无线攻击工具
- 二次开发支持
2. 选择合适的手机型号
NetHunter支持多种Android设备,以下是一些完美适配NetHunter的手机型号:
2.1 Nexus系列
- Nexus 5
- Nexus 6
- Nexus 7(2013)
- Nexus 9
2.2 OnePlus系列
- OnePlus 3/3T
- OnePlus 5/5T
2.3 Meizu系列
- Meizu MX5
2.4 Xiaomi系列
- Xiaomi Mi 5
- Xiaomi Redmi Note 3
2.5 其他设备
- 许多其他设备也可以运行NetHunter,但可能需要一些额外的配置和驱动程序。
3. 安装NetHunter
以下是安装NetHunter的步骤:
3.1 准备工作
- 确保您的设备已开启USB调试。
- 下载NetHunter安装镜像文件。
- 将镜像文件传输到设备。
3.2 安装过程
- 打开ADB(Android Debug Bridge)。
- 执行以下命令安装TWRP(Team Win Recovery Project):
fastboot oem unlock
fastboot flash recovery twrp.img
- 重启设备并进入TWRP。
- 选择“Wipe”并执行“Swipe to Factory Reset”。
- 选择“Install”并选择NetHunter镜像文件。
- 选择“Swipe to Confirm Flash”。
- 重启设备。
4. 配置NetHunter
4.1 更新系统
- 打开终端。
- 输入以下命令更新系统:
sudo apt-get update
sudo apt-get upgrade
4.2 安装额外工具
- 打开终端。
- 输入以下命令安装额外工具:
sudo apt-get install metasploit-framework
sudo apt-get install nmap
sudo apt-get install wireshark
5. 使用NetHunter
NetHunter提供了丰富的工具和功能,以下是一些基本操作:
- 使用Kali Linux工具集进行渗透测试。
- 使用VPN连接到远程服务器。
- 使用网络监控和嗅探工具。
6. 总结
NetHunter是一款功能强大的Android操作系统,适用于渗透测试和安全研究。通过选择合适的手机型号并按照本文步骤进行安装和配置,您可以轻松上手NetHunter,并在安全环境中执行各种安全测试。
